Crawdaunt G worth
Supreme Victors · #23 · rare · Updated Aug 5, 2026
$2.55
Live raw market estimate · PSA 10 n/a
Current market prices
| TCGplayer market | $2.55 |
| Cardmarket low | €0.99 (~$1.14) |
| TCGplayer mid | $1.70 |
| PSA 10 (eBay median) | - |

Crawdaunt G #23, featured in the Supreme Victors set, is a rare Pokémon card that has captured the attention of collectors and players alike. Illustrated by the talented artist Wataru Kawahara, this card not only showcases the unique design of Crawdaunt but also plays a role in various gameplay strategies.
